On July 19, 2024, an unusual event unfolded in St. Petersburg, Florida, drawing significant attention from both local residents and the broader community. Federal agents and police officers descended upon two local businesses, Ace Loans and Rico Paint and Body Auto, located at 510 34th St S, St. Petersburg, FL 33711. This coordinated action has left many residents puzzled and concerned, as the authorities have yet to disclose the reasons behind the operation.

The sight of numerous law enforcement vehicles and personnel in the typically quiet neighborhood created a scene of high drama. Neighbors and passersby observed agents in tactical gear and police officers securing the area around the businesses. The presence of federal agents alongside local police suggests that this operation was of considerable significance, likely involving issues beyond the scope of routine local law enforcement activities.

While the specific details of the investigation remain undisclosed, the heavy police presence indicates that the authorities were acting on substantial information or leads.
